On Monday, Kanye West seemed to remove all of his Instagram postings regarding his ex-wife Kim Kardashian West and their children.
On his public Instagram feed, the rapper has only six postings. The action comes just days after Ye publicly sought suggestions from his Instagram followers on what to do about his daughter participating in TikTok videos against his consent.
"Because this is my first divorce, I'm not sure what I should do about my kid being forced to use TikTok?" Ye captioned the photo, tagging Kardashian West. In an Instagram story, Kardashian West reacted, claiming that "continuous assaults" on her in interviews and on social media were "more cruel than any TikTok North West would produce."
"Divorce is painful enough for our children, and Kanye's preoccupation with attempting to control and manipulate our situation in such a terrible and public way is just adding to our misery," Kardashian West said in the article.
